Vascular cognitive impairment. Use of naftidrofuryl
The article is devoted to the diagnosis and treatment of vascular cognitive impairment of different severity. The focus is on medication and non-medication therapeutic methods that have proven effective in large studies.

Vascular cognitive impairment: Current concepts and Indian perspective
Cognitive impairment due to cerebrovascular disease is termed "Vascular Cognitive Impairment" (VCI) and forms a spectrum that includes Vascular Dementia (VaD) and milder forms of cognitive impairment referred to as Vascular Mild Cognitive Impairment ...
